District Overview
Located at 9624 256th St N in Port Byron, Illinois, Riverdale CUSD 100 serves as an educational cornerstone within a rural fringe setting in the broader Davenport-Moline-Rock Island metropolitan area. As an open, traditional public school district operating independently of charter models, Riverdale encompasses three operational schools that offer a continuous educational pathway spanning from pre-kindergarten through 12th grade. The district's cohesive campus structure and community-centered environment provide families with accessible primary and secondary education grounded in a strong local identity.
For the 2024–2025 academic year, the district educates a student body of 1,095 learners, maintaining balanced cohort sizes from early childhood programs through high school graduation. To effectively support student achievement and development, Riverdale CUSD 100 relies on a comprehensive workforce of over 350 full-time equivalent staff members, featuring approximately 170 classroom teachers alongside 18 instructional aides and dedicated support personnel. This generous staffing baseline ensures individualized instruction, strong administrative framework, and robust student support services, making the district a compelling model for parents, community members, and educational researchers alike.

Demographics
District Demographics Data Table
| Demographic | Student Count |
|---|---|
| White | 959 |
| Hispanic | 79 |
| Black | 9 |
| Asian | 7 |
| Two or More | 37 |
| American Indian | 2 |
